Job SummaryWe are seeking part-time instructors to teach Electrical Construction I & II, including both lecture and hands-on lab components. These courses cover residential, commercial, and industrial wiring, combining classroom theory with practical, real-world training. Day and evening teaching opportunities are available.
Job Duties- Deliver in-person instruction in both theoretical and practical aspects of electrical construction.
- Facilitate hands‑on lab activities that simulate real‑world electrical work environments.
- Maintain classroom and lab spaces, including tools and training materials.
- Stay current with industry trends, technologies, and code updates to ensure course content remains relevant.
- Support student learning and success through mentorship and engagement.
- Credential in the field of study;
Associate's degree preferred. - Alternatively, a valid Journeyman Electrician or Master Electrician license with documented industry training may substitute for a degree.
- Minimum of 2 years of relevant field experience; 5 years preferred.
- Kentucky Journeyman or Master Electrician License strongly preferred.
- Prior teaching experience at the community college level is a plus.
- Commitment to supporting a diverse student population and fostering an inclusive learning environment.
- Comprehensive knowledge of residential, commercial, and industrial electrical systems, including materials, tools, and the National Electrical Code (NEC).
- Skilled in interpreting blueprints, wiring diagrams, and schematics, with hands‑on experience in installation, troubleshooting, and repair.
- Effective instructional and communication skills, with the ability to clearly demonstrate technical procedures and engage students in both classroom and lab settings.
- Commitment to safety and industry best practices, including adherence to OSHA standards and safe use of hand and power tools.
- Ability to support diverse learners, stay current with industry trends, and contribute to a collaborative, student‑centered learning environment.
